[0021] An embodiment of the present invention provides a method for measuring the temperature rise of a motor, which is used to measure the temperature rise during the operation of the motor to provide data for monitoring the operation of the motor.

[0022] figure 1 The flow chart of the motor temperature rise measurement method provided by the embodiment of the present invention, such as figure 1 As shown, the measurement method specifically includes:

[0023] Step 1. Collect the current value and rotational speed value of the motor.

[0024] The collection of the current value can be collected through an additional current sensor or ammeter, or the current value collected by the existing control system of the motor can be used as the current value in this measurement method.

Abstract

The invention discloses a motor temperature rise measurement method and a motor temperature rise measurement device. The measurement method comprises the following steps of collecting current values and rotation speed values of a motor; calculating copper loss values of the motor according to the collected current values and calculating iron loss values of the motor according to the collected rotation speed values; calculating loss values of the motor according to the copper loss values and the iron loss values; and looking up temperature rise values of the motor under the corresponding losses in a database according to the loss values. With the adoption of the measurement method, no temperature rise detection device is required to be specially installed for detection on the motor temperature rise, as well as no power detection device is required to be specially installed for the measurement of input powers and output powers for the calculation of motor loss; and therefore, the complicated procedures of installing the temperature rise detection device or the power detection device in the motor are omitted, and moreover, the cost is lowered.
